/**
* The Simulator is just a collection of methods that take a Stalker's build as input and compute
* DPS information as output.
*
* Most of the Simulator's assumptions are configurable in Simulator.ABILITIES and Simulator.AMPS.
* Actual ability/amp implementations are found in Simulator.getDamage.
*/
function bound(low, high, number){
return Math.max(low, Math.min(high, number));
}
var Simulator = {};
/**
* Abilities used for doing damage. Nano-skin Lethal is assumed and factored into the coefficients.
* To remove this, divide the coefficient by 1.18, or 1.22 for abilities that deal tech damage, as
* they still receive the pre-nerf bonus.
*/
Simulator.ABILITIES = {
IMPALE: {
GCD: 0.5,
COOLDOWN: 0,
TYPE: 'ASSAULT',
SUIT_POWER_COST: 35,
T8_SUIT_POWER_COST: 30,
T4_ARMOR_PIERCE: 0.5,
AP_BASE_COEFFICIENT: 0.944,
AP_TIER_COEFFICIENT: 0.0472,
BASE_DAMAGE: 2225.48,
DAMAGE_TYPE: 'phys'
},
SHRED: {
GCD: 1.05,
COOLDOWN: 0,
TYPE: 'ASSAULT',
SUIT_POWER_COST: 0,
HIT_COUNT: 3,
AP_BASE_COEFFICIENT: 0.114106,
AP_TIER_COEFFICIENT: 0.013924,
BASE_DAMAGE: 293.7964,
T4_ARMOR_PIERCE: 0.38,
// Shred's SP regeneration is bugged and doesn't actually give 2 SP/s.
T8_SPPS: 1.6,
DAMAGE_TYPE: 'phys'
},
ANALYZE_WEAKNESS: {
GCD: 0,
COOLDOWN: 8,
TYPE: 'ASSAULT',
SUIT_POWER_COST: 15,
AP_BASE_COEFFICIENT: 0.613904,
AP_TIER_COEFFICIENT: 0.027694,
BASE_DAMAGE: 1334.68,
T4_SPPS: 2,
T4_BUFF_DURATION: 5,
T8_AVERAGE_CDR: 1.125,
DAMAGE_TYPE: 'tech'
},
PUNISH: {
GCD: 0,
COOLDOWN: 8,
TYPE: 'ASSAULT',
SUIT_POWER_COST: 0,
AP_BASE_COEFFICIENT: 0.64369,
AP_TIER_COEFFICIENT: 0.08201,
BASE_DAMAGE: 1400.66,
SPPU: 30,
T8_SPPU: 45,
T4_EXPOSE: 0.045,
T4_EXPOSE_DURATION: 6,
DAMAGE_TYPE: 'phys'
},
RUIN: {
GCD: 0.5,
COOLDOWN: 11,
TYPE: 'ASSAULT',
SUIT_POWER_COST: 10,
AP_BASE_COEFFICIENT: 0.167262,
AP_TIER_COEFFICIENT: 0.013908,
BASE_DAMAGE: 364.17,
SPPT: 2,
TICK_COUNT: 10,
DAMAGE_TYPE: 'tech',
DOT: {
AP_BASE_COEFFICIENT: 0.066246,
AP_TIER_COEFFICIENT: 0.00488,
BASE_DAMAGE: 161.65
}
},
CONCUSSIVE_KICKS: {
GCD: 0.75,
COOLDOWN: 8,
TYPE: 'ASSAULT',
SUIT_POWER_COST: 15,
HIT_COUNT: 2,
AP_BASE_COEFFICIENT: 0.455952,
AP_TIER_COEFFICIENT: 0.02832,
BASE_DAMAGE: 967.6,
T8_ASSAULT_CDR: 2,
T8_CDR_EFFECTIVENESS: 0.8,
DAMAGE_TYPE: 'phys'
},
COLLAPSE: {
GCD: 0,
COOLDOWN: 25,
TYPE: 'UTILITY',
SUIT_POWER_COST: 0,
AP_BASE_COEFFICIENT: 0.263966,
AP_TIER_COEFFICIENT: 0.059,
SP_BASE_COEFFICIENT: 0.2237,
SP_TIER_COEFFICIENT: 0.05,
BASE_DAMAGE: 973.5,
DAMAGE_TYPE: 'phys'
},
STAGGER: {
GCD: 0,
COOLDOWN: 25,
T4_CDR: 7,
TYPE: 'UTILITY',
SUIT_POWER_COST: 0,
HIT_COUNT: 4,
AP_BASE_COEFFICIENT: 0.0413,
AP_TIER_COEFFICIENT: 0.0059,
SP_BASE_COEFFICIENT: 0.035,
SP_TIER_COEFFICIENT: 0.005,
BASE_DAMAGE: 177,
DAMAGE_TYPE: 'phys'
},
PREPARATION: {
GCD: 0,
COOLDOWN: 15,
TYPE: 'UTILITY',
SUIT_POWER_COST: 0,
SPPT: 6,
AVERAGE_TICKS: 2,
TICKS_PER_SECOND: 2,
BUFF_DURATION_AVERAGE: 4.5,
CRIT_CHANCE_AVERAGE: 0.0567,
BONUS_CRIT_CHANCE_PER_TIER: 0.005
},
TACTICAL_RETREAT: {
GCD: 0,
COOLDOWN: 30,
TYPE: 'UTILITY'
},
STEALTH: {
COOLDOWN: 25,
TYPE: 'NONE'
}
};
/**
* AMPs that deal damage. Nano-skin Lethal is assumed and factored into the coefficients.
* To remove this, divide the coefficient by 1.18.
*/
Simulator.AMPS = {
UNFAIR_ADVANTAGE: {
SUIT_POWER_REDUCTION: 8
},
STEALTH_MASTERY: {
CDR: 3
},
RIPOSTE: {
BUFF_DURATION: 5,
STRIKETHROUGH_PERCENT: 0.06,
ABILITIES_TO_IGNORE: ['RUIN.DOT', 'FATAL_WOUNDS', 'CUTTHROAT', 'DEVASTATE']
},
ONSLAUGHT: {
AP_BUFF: 0.12
},
FATAL_WOUNDS: {
MAX_STACKS: 5,
AP_COEFFICIENT: 0.03186,
ABILITIES_TO_IGNORE: ['RUIN.DOT', 'FATAL_WOUNDS', 'CUTTHROAT', 'DEVASTATE']
},
ENABLER: {
SPPS: 3,
// Since Enabler is bugged and does not grant SP while below 25, this is an assumption that
// roughly 30% of your time is spent below 25, even if you make a conscious effort to
// straddle it.
EFFECTIVENESS: 0.7
},
CUTTHROAT: {
STACKS_TIL_DAMAGE: 10,
ICD: 0.33,
AP_COEFFICIENT: 0.5192,
ABILITIES_TO_IGNORE: ['ANALYZE_WEAKNESS', 'RUIN.DOT', 'FATAL_WOUNDS', 'CUTTHROAT', 'DEVASTATE']
},
DEVASTATE: {
PERCENT_LIFE_THRESHOLD: 0.25,
AP_COEFFICIENT: 0.3186,
ABILITIES_TO_IGNORE: ['ANALYZE_WEAKNESS', 'RUIN.DOT', 'FATAL_WOUNDS', 'CUTTHROAT', 'DEVASTATE']
},
KILLER_INSTINCT: {
ABILITIES_TO_IGNORE: ['ANALYZE_WEAKNESS', 'RUIN.DOT', 'FATAL_WOUNDS', 'CUTTHROAT', 'DEVASTATE']
}
};
// Base Suit Power regeneration rate, per second.
Simulator.BASE_SPPS = 7;
(function(){
// Camel cases a constant name, e.g. camelCase('SOME_SKILL_NAME') => 'someSkillName'.
var camelCase = function(str){
return str.toLowerCase().replace(/_(\w)/g, function(match, letter){
return letter.toUpperCase();
});
};
// Finds the ability named, resolving periods.
var getAbility = function(name){
var nameParts = name.split('.');
var ability = Simulator.ABILITIES;
while (nameParts.length) ability = ability[nameParts.shift()];
return ability;
}
// Creates a function that will determine the damage a Stalker will do for the given ability name.
var damageForAbility = function(name){
var nameParts = name.split('.');
var ability = getAbility(name);
name = camelCase(nameParts[0]);
return function(stalker){
var tier = stalker[name];
if (tier < 0) return 0;
var damage = ability.BASE_DAMAGE;
var ap = stalker.assaultPower;
var sp = stalker.supportPower;
var apCoefficient = (ability.AP_BASE_COEFFICIENT || 0) + (ability.AP_TIER_COEFFICIENT || 0) * tier;
var spCoefficient = (ability.SP_BASE_COEFFICIENT || 0) + (ability.SP_TIER_COEFFICIENT || 0) * tier;
damage += (ap * apCoefficient) + (sp * spCoefficient);
return damage;
};
};
// Creates a function that will determine the damage a Stalker will do for the given AMP name.
var damageForAmp = function(){
return function(stalker, apCoefficient){
return stalker.assaultPower * apCoefficient;
};
};
// Functions to determine the damage of each ability we care about.
var impaleDamage = damageForAbility('IMPALE');
var shredDamage = damageForAbility('SHRED');
var analyzeWeaknessDamage = damageForAbility('ANALYZE_WEAKNESS');
var punishDamage = damageForAbility('PUNISH');
var ruinDamage = damageForAbility('RUIN');
var ruinDotDamage = damageForAbility('RUIN.DOT');
var concussiveKicksDamage = damageForAbility('CONCUSSIVE_KICKS');
var staggerDamage = damageForAbility('STAGGER');
var collapseDamage = damageForAbility('COLLAPSE');
var devastateDamage = damageForAmp('DEVASTATE');
var cutthroatDamage = damageForAmp('CUTTHROAT');
var fatalWoundsDamage = damageForAmp('FATAL_WOUNDS');
// Determines the cooldown of an ability.
var cooldown = function(stalker, name){
var cdr = stalker.cooldownReduction;
if (Simulator.ABILITIES[name].TYPE === 'ASSAULT' && name != 'CONCUSSIVE_KICKS'){
cdr = stalker.assaultCooldownReduction;
}
return Simulator.ABILITIES[name].COOLDOWN * (1 - cdr);
}
// Determines the cooldown of the Stalker's Nanoskin.
var stealthCooldown = function(stalker){
var cdr = stalker.stealthMastery ? Simulator.AMPS.STEALTH_MASTERY.CDR : 0;
return Simulator.ABILITIES.STEALTH.COOLDOWN - cdr;
}
// Utility to clone an object.
var shallowClone = function(obj){
return Object.keys(obj).reduce(function(result, key){
result[key] = obj[key];
return result;
}, {});
}
// Determines the amount of suit power that will be generated over the course of a fight.
var calculateTotalSuitPower = function(stalker, duration){
var sp = duration * Simulator.BASE_SPPS;
if (stalker.shred === 8){
sp += duration * Simulator.ABILITIES.SHRED.T8_SPPS;
}
if (stalker.analyzeWeakness > 3){
var awCooldown = cooldown(stalker, 'ANALYZE_WEAKNESS');
if (stalker.analyzeWeakness === 8) awCooldown -= Simulator.ABILITIES.ANALYZE_WEAKNESS.T8_AVERAGE_CDR;
if (awCooldown <= Simulator.ABILITIES.ANALYZE_WEAKNESS.T4_BUFF_DURATION){
sp += duration * Simulator.ABILITIES.ANALYZE_WEAKNESS.T4_SPPS;
} else{
sp += (duration / awCooldown) * Simulator.ABILITIES.ANALYZE_WEAKNESS.T4_BUFF_DURATION *
Simulator.ABILITIES.ANALYZE_WEAKNESS.T4_SPPS;
}
}
if (stalker.ruin > 3){
var deflectChance = bound(0, 1, (stalker.enemyDeflectChance - stalker.strikeThroughChance));
var ruinApplications = (duration / Simulator.ABILITIES.RUIN.COOLDOWN) * (1 - deflectChance);
var totalRuinTicks = ruinApplications * Simulator.ABILITIES.RUIN.TICK_COUNT;
sp += totalRuinTicks * Simulator.ABILITIES.RUIN.SPPT;
}
if (stalker.punish > -1){
var sppu = stalker.punish === 8 ? Simulator.ABILITIES.PUNISH.T8_SPPU : Simulator.ABILITIES.PUNISH.SPPU;
sp += (duration / cooldown(stalker, 'PUNISH')) * sppu;
}
if (stalker.preparation > -1){
var spPerPrep = (Simulator.ABILITIES.PREPARATION.AVERAGE_TICKS * Simulator.ABILITIES.PREPARATION.SPPT);
sp += (duration / cooldown(stalker, 'PREPARATION')) * spPerPrep;
}
if (stalker.enabler){
sp += Simulator.AMPS.ENABLER.SPPS * duration * Simulator.AMPS.ENABLER.EFFECTIVENESS;
}
return sp + 100;
};
// Determines how much damage is done after factoring in mitigation and armor pierce.
var damageReduction = function(damage, stalker, extraArmorPierce){
var mitigation = stalker.enemyMitigation;
var pierce = bound(0, 1, (stalker.armorPierce + extraArmorPierce));
// Pierce only cuts through armor, which accounts for half of the enemy's mitigation.
// Therefore we consider half of the damage with pierce and half without.
var effectiveMitigation = ((1 - pierce) * mitigation) * 0.5;
effectiveMitigation += mitigation * 0.5;
return damage * (1 - effectiveMitigation);
};
// Determines how much damage each of the Stalker's abilities will do.
var getAbilityDamage = function(stalker, duration){
var timeLeft = duration;
var suitPower = calculateTotalSuitPower(stalker, duration);
var deflectChance = bound(0, 1, stalker.enemyDeflectChance - stalker.strikeThroughChance);
var getAbilityStats = function(options){
options.cdAdjustment = options.cdAdjustment || 0;
var ability = getAbility(options.abilityName);
var swings = options.swings || 0;
if (!swings){
if (ability.SUIT_POWER_COST && !ability.COOLDOWN){
swings = suitPower / (options.spCost || ability.SUIT_POWER_COST);
} else if (!ability.SUIT_POWER_COST && !ability.COOLDOWN && !options.cooldown){
swings = timeLeft / ability.GCD;
} else {
var cd = 0;
if (options.cooldown){
cd = options.cooldown;
} else {
cd = cooldown(stalker, options.abilityName) + options.cdAdjustment;
}
swings = duration / cd;
}
}
swings *= (options.swingAdjustment || 1);
var timeUsed = swings * (ability.GCD || 0);
var suitPowerUsed = (options.spCost || ability.SUIT_POWER_COST || 0) * swings;
swings *= (ability.HIT_COUNT || 1);
if (options.forceCrits){
swings -= options.forceCrits;
}
var hits = swings * (1 - deflectChance);
var crits = hits * stalker.critHitChance;
if (options.forceCrits){
crits += options.forceCrits;
hits += options.forceCrits;
swings += options.forceCrits;
}
var rawDamage = options.damageFn(stalker) * ((stalker.critHitSeverity * crits) + (hits - crits));
return {
label: options.abilityName,
swings: swings,
hits: hits,
crits: crits,
nonCrits: hits - crits,
deflects: swings - hits,
rawDamage: rawDamage,
damageType: ability.DAMAGE_TYPE,
damage: damageReduction(rawDamage, stalker, options.armorPierce || 0),
suitPowerUsed: suitPowerUsed,
timeUsed: timeUsed
};
}
var abilities = [];
if (stalker.punish > -1){
var punish = getAbilityStats({
abilityName: 'PUNISH',
damageFn: punishDamage
});
abilities.push(punish);
abilities.PUNISH = punish;
}
if (stalker.concussiveKicks > -1){
var ckAdjustment = 0;
var swingsAdjustment = 0;
if (stalker.concussiveKicks > 3){
ckAdjustment = Simulator.ABILITIES.CONCUSSIVE_KICKS.GCD;
swingsAdjustment = 2;
}
var ck = getAbilityStats({
abilityName: 'CONCUSSIVE_KICKS',
damageFn: concussiveKicksDamage,
cdAdjustment: ckAdjustment,
swingAdjustment: swingsAdjustment
});
suitPower -= ck.suitPowerUsed;
timeLeft -= ck.timeUsed;
abilities.push(ck);
abilities.CONCUSSIVE_KICKS = ck;
}
if (stalker.ruin > -1){
var ruin = getAbilityStats({
abilityName: 'RUIN',
damageFn: ruinDamage
});
suitPower -= ruin.suitPowerUsed;
timeLeft -= ruin.timeUsed;
var ruinDot = getAbilityStats({
abilityName: 'RUIN.DOT',
damageFn: ruinDotDamage,
swings: ruin.hits,
swingAdjustment: Simulator.ABILITIES.RUIN.TICK_COUNT,
cooldown: Simulator.ABILITIES.RUIN.COOLDOWN
});
abilities.push(ruin, ruinDot);
abilities.RUIN = ruin;
abilities.RUIN_DOT = ruinDot;
}
if (stalker.analyzeWeakness > -1){
var awCdr = stalker.analyzeWeakness === 8 ? -Simulator.ABILITIES.ANALYZE_WEAKNESS.T8_AVERAGE_CDR : 0;
var aw = getAbilityStats({
abilityName: 'ANALYZE_WEAKNESS',
damageFn: analyzeWeaknessDamage,
cdAdjustment: awCdr
});
suitPower -= aw.suitPowerUsed;
abilities.push(aw);
abilities.ANALYZE_WEAKNESS = aw;
}
if (stalker.collapse > -1){
var collapse = getAbilityStats({
abilityName: 'COLLAPSE',
damageFn: collapseDamage
});
abilities.push(collapse);
abilities.COLLAPSE = collapse;
}
if (stalker.stagger > -1){
var stagger = getAbilityStats({
abilityName: 'STAGGER',
damageFn: staggerDamage,
cdAdjustment: stalker.stagger > 3 ? -Simulator.ABILITIES.STAGGER.T4_CDR : 0
});
abilities.push(stagger);
abilities.STAGGER = stagger;
}
if (stalker.impale > -1){
var stealthCount = duration / stealthCooldown(stalker);
if(stalker.tacticalRetreat > -1){
stealthCount += duration / cooldown(stalker, 'TACTICAL_RETREAT');
}
var spCost = stalker.impale < 8 ? Simulator.ABILITIES.IMPALE.SUIT_POWER_COST : Simulator.ABILITIES.IMPALE.T8_SUIT_POWER_COST;
var armorPierce = stalker.impale > 3 ? Simulator.ABILITIES.IMPALE.T4_ARMOR_PIERCE : 0;
if (stalker.unfairAdvantage){
suitPower += stealthCount * Simulator.AMPS.UNFAIR_ADVANTAGE.SUIT_POWER_REDUCTION;
}
var impale = getAbilityStats({
abilityName: 'IMPALE',
damageFn: impaleDamage,
spCost: spCost,
armorPierce: armorPierce,
forceCrits: stealthCount
});
suitPower -= impale.suitPowerUsed;
timeLeft -= impale.timeUsed;
abilities.push(impale);
abilities.IMPALE = impale;
}
if (stalker.shred > -1){
armorPierce = stalker.shred >= 4 ? Simulator.ABILITIES.SHRED.T4_ARMOR_PIERCE : 0;
var shred = getAbilityStats({
abilityName: 'SHRED',
damageFn: shredDamage,
armorPierce: armorPierce
});
abilities.push(shred);
abilities.SHRED = shred;
}
if (stalker.fatalWounds){
var totalCrits = abilities.reduce(function(crits, ability){
if (Simulator.AMPS.FATAL_WOUNDS.ABILITIES_TO_IGNORE.indexOf(ability.label) === -1){
crits += ability.crits;
}
return crits;
}, 0);
var secondsBetweenCrits = duration / totalCrits;
var fwTimeLeft = duration;
var fwHits = 0;
var currentStacks = 0;
while (currentStacks < Simulator.AMPS.FATAL_WOUNDS.MAX_STACKS && timeLeft > 0){
currentStacks++;
// We'll tick secondsBetweenCrits times before the next stack is added.
fwHits += Math.floor(secondsBetweenCrits) * currentStacks;
fwTimeLeft -= secondsBetweenCrits;
}
fwHits += fwTimeLeft * currentStacks;
var fwDamage = fatalWoundsDamage(stalker, Simulator.AMPS.FATAL_WOUNDS.AP_COEFFICIENT) * fwHits;
var fw = {
label: 'FATAL_WOUNDS',
swings: fwHits,
hits: fwHits,
crits: 0,
nonCrits: fwHits,
deflects: 0,
rawDamage: fwDamage,
damageType: Simulator.AMPS.FATAL_WOUNDS.DAMAGE_TYPE,
damage: damageReduction(fwDamage, stalker, 1),
suitPowerUsed: 0,
timeUsed: 0
};
abilities.push(fw);
abilities.FATAL_WOUNDS = fw;
}
if (stalker.cutthroat){
var totalHits = abilities.reduce(function(hits, ability){
if (Simulator.AMPS.CUTTHROAT.ABILITIES_TO_IGNORE.indexOf(ability.label) === -1){
hits += ability.hits
}
return hits;
}, 0);
totalHits = Math.max(totalHits, duration / Simulator.AMPS.CUTTHROAT.ICD)
var ctSwings = totalHits / Simulator.AMPS.CUTTHROAT.STACKS_TIL_DAMAGE;
var ctCrits = ctSwings * stalker.critHitChance;
var ctHits = ((ctSwings - ctCrits) * (1 - deflectChance)) + ctCrits;
var ctBaseDamage = cutthroatDamage(stalker, Simulator.AMPS.CUTTHROAT.AP_COEFFICIENT);
var ctDamage = ctBaseDamage * ((stalker.critHitSeverity * ctCrits) + (ctHits - ctCrits));
var ct = {
label: 'CUTTHROAT',
swings: ctSwings,
hits: ctHits,
crits: ctCrits,
nonCrits: ctHits - ctCrits,
deflects: ctSwings - ctHits,
rawDamage: ctDamage,
damageType: Simulator.AMPS.CUTTHROAT.DAMAGE_TYPE,
damage: damageReduction(ctDamage, stalker, 0),
suitPowerUsed: 0,
timeUsed: 0
};
abilities.push(ct);
abilities.CUTTHROAT = ct;
}
if (stalker.devastate){
var totalCrits = abilities.reduce(function(crits, ability){
if (Simulator.AMPS.DEVASTATE.ABILITIES_TO_IGNORE.indexOf(ability.label) === -1){
crits += ability.crits;
}
return crits;
}, 0);
var dHits = totalCrits * Simulator.AMPS.DEVASTATE.PERCENT_LIFE_THRESHOLD;
var dDamage = devastateDamage(stalker, Simulator.AMPS.DEVASTATE.AP_COEFFICIENT) * dHits;
var devastate = {
label: 'DEVASTATE',
swings: dHits,
hits: dHits,
crits: 0,
nonCrits: dHits,
deflects: 0,
rawDamage: dDamage,
damageType: Simulator.AMPS.DEVASTATE.DAMAGE_TYPE,
damage: damageReduction(dDamage, stalker, 1),
suitPowerUsed: 0,
timeUsed: 0
};
abilities.push(devastate);
abilities.DEVASTATE = ct;
}
return abilities;
};
// Determines how much damage the Stalker will do in a fight.
var getDamage = function(stalker, duration){
stalker = shallowClone(stalker);
if (stalker.onslaught){
stalker.assaultPower *= (1 + Simulator.AMPS.ONSLAUGHT.AP_BUFF);
}
if (stalker.concussiveKicks === 8){
var abilities = getAbilityDamage(stalker, duration);
var ck = abilities.CONCUSSIVE_KICKS;
var CK = Simulator.ABILITIES.CONCUSSIVE_KICKS;
var ckUseCount = ck.swings / CK.HIT_COUNT;
stalker.assaultCooldownReduction += ((ckUseCount * CK.T8_ASSAULT_CDR) / duration) *
CK.T8_CDR_EFFECTIVENESS;
}
if (stalker.riposte){
var deflects = getAbilityDamage(stalker, duration).reduce(function(deflects, ability){
if (Simulator.AMPS.RIPOSTE.ABILITIES_TO_IGNORE.indexOf(ability.label) === -1){
deflects += ability.deflects;
}
return deflects;
}, 0);
var secondsBetweenDeflects = duration / deflects;
var riposteBuffCount = (duration / secondsBetweenDeflects) - 1;
var riposteUptime = bound(0, 1, (riposteBuffCount * Simulator.AMPS.RIPOSTE.BUFF_DURATION) / duration);
stalker.strikeThroughChance += riposteUptime * Simulator.AMPS.RIPOSTE.STRIKETHROUGH_PERCENT;
}
if (stalker.preparation > -1){
var PREP = Simulator.ABILITIES.PREPARATION;
var prepCastTime = PREP.AVERAGE_TICKS / PREP.TICKS_PER_SECOND;
var prepCooldown = cooldown(stalker, 'PREPARATION') + prepCastTime;
var prepUptime = PREP.BUFF_DURATION_AVERAGE / prepCooldown;
stalker.critHitChance += (PREP.CRIT_CHANCE_AVERAGE + (PREP.BONUS_CRIT_CHANCE_PER_TIER * stalker.preparation)) * prepUptime;
}
if (stalker.killerInstinct){
var nonCrits = getAbilityDamage(stalker, duration).reduce(function(nonCrits, ability){
if (Simulator.AMPS.KILLER_INSTINCT.ABILITIES_TO_IGNORE.indexOf(ability.label) === -1){
nonCrits += ability.nonCrits;
}
return nonCrits;
}, 0);
stalker.critHitChance += (1 / (duration / nonCrits)) / 100;
}
var abilities = getAbilityDamage(stalker, duration);
if (stalker.punish > 3){
var punishHits = abilities.PUNISH.hits;
var exposeDuration = punishHits * Simulator.ABILITIES.PUNISH.T4_EXPOSE_DURATION;
exposeDuration = Math.min(exposeDuration, duration);
var uptime = exposeDuration / duration;
abilities.forEach(function(ability){
if(ability.damageType === 'phys'){
ability.rawDamage *= (1 + (Simulator.ABILITIES.PUNISH.T4_EXPOSE * uptime));
ability.damage *= (1 + (Simulator.ABILITIES.PUNISH.T4_EXPOSE * uptime));
}
});
}
var damage = abilities.reduce(function(total, ability){
return total + ability.damage;
}, 0);
return {
abilities: abilities,
damage: damage,
dps: damage / duration
};
};
// Determines the damage done by the Stalker after a given change of stats.
var getDamageAfterChange = function(stalker, duration, change){
var oldSeverity = stalker.critHitSeverity;
if (change.critSeverityRating){
stalker.critHitSeverity = getSeverity(
getSeverityRating(oldSeverity) + change.critSeverityRating);
delete change.critSeverityRating;
}
Object.keys(change).forEach(function(stat){
stalker[stat] += change[stat];
});
var damage = Simulator.getDamage(stalker, duration);
Object.keys(change).forEach(function(stat){
stalker[stat] -= change[stat];
});
stalker.critHitSeverity = oldSeverity;
return damage;
};
// Determines how much critical severity rating is needed for 1% crit severity.
var severityRatingNeeded = function(stalker){
var rating = getSeverityRating(stalker.critHitSeverity);
var A = 0.71428573177128007;
var B = 1441.2620313260343;
var C = 2017.7665934446297;
// f(x) = A - B / (x + C)
// f(x + a) - f(x) = 0.01
// a = -(C + x)^2 / (-100B + C + x)
return (-1 * Math.pow(C + rating, 2)) / ((-100 * B) + C + rating);
};
// Determines the critical severity rating from the severity. This is the inverse of getSeverity.
var getSeverityRating = function(severity){
var A = 0.71428573177128007;
var B = 1441.2620313260343;
var C = 2017.7665934446297;
// f(x) = A - B / (x + C)
// x = (-AC + B + Cy) / (A - y)
severity -= 1.62;
return ((-1 * A * C) + B + (C * severity)) / (A - severity);
}
// Determines the critical severity from a severity rating. This is the inverse of getSeverityRating.
var getSeverity = function(rating){
var A = 0.71428573177128007;
var B = 1441.2620313260343;
var C = 2017.7665934446297;
// f(x) = A - B / (x + C)
var severity = A - (B / (rating + C));
return severity + 1.62;
}
Simulator.getDamage = getDamage;
Simulator.getDamageAfterChange = getDamageAfterChange;
Simulator.getSeverityRating = getSeverityRating;
Simulator.getSeverity = getSeverity;
Simulator.severityRatingNeeded = severityRatingNeeded;
})();
